Senior Developer (Full Stack Developer)

Ovyo
Municipality of Madrid, Spain
3 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ior

Job location

Municipality of Madrid, Spain

Tech stack

Amazon Web Services (AWS)
Databases
ETL
Data Visualization
IBM DB2
Python
Shell
Node.js
Power BI
Systems Integration
Qliksense
Spring-boot
Backend
Angular
Data Analytics
Front End Software Development
Data Pipelines
Databricks
Control M

Job description

Senior Full-Stack Developer - Python Hybrid: Malaga Short term contract - End of Dec 2025 IMMEDIATE AVAILABILITY NEEDED Ovyo is an professional services company specializing in the satellite, telecommunications, media, and broadcasting, transportation and many more sectors. Our management team is located in the UK and Portugal and we have technical teams based across Europe and India. Develop and maintain full-stack applications using Python, Spring Boot, and Angular across backend and frontend systems. Build and optimize data pipelines, including high-volume data loading into DB2 using Loader and querying via Databricks. Create insightful data analytics and visualizations using Power BI and Qlik Sense. Consume, process, and manage data within AWS services. Automate execution flows using Control-M and enhance backend capabilities with Node.js. Write robust UNIX Shell scripts to support system integration and automation. Ensure system scalability, performance, and reliability in a hybrid

Requirements

cloud/on-prem environment. Minimum 5 years of hands-on experience in Python development. Proven expertise in full-stack development with Spring Boot and Angular Strong proficiency in UNIX Shell scripting. Advanced knowledge of DB2 databases Hands-on experience with data analytics and visualization tools: Power BI and Qlik Sense. Practical experience consuming and managing data in AWS services. Familiarity with Control-M for scheduling and Node.js for backend development. Solid understanding of technical architecture and functional requirements in financial control or similar domains.

Apply for this position